Children charged with armed robbery and stabbing of 11-year-old girl in Frankston

Police have charged two children aged 12 and 14 over the alleged attack. (ABC News: Margaret Burin)

Police in Melbourne have charged two children over the alleged armed robbery and stabbing of an 11-year-old girl in the early hours of Thursday morning.

Police said the girl was on Gallery Lane near Frankston's Bayside Centre shops in the city's south-east just after midnight when she was approached by three other children.

Officers believe the trio then demanded the girl hand over her mobile phone and personal items before stabbing her several times with "a sharp implement".

Nearby transit police officers arrested the three alleged attackers and the 11-year-old girl was taken to hospital with non-life threatening injuries, police said.

A 14-year-old boy and 12-year-old girl were charged with armed robbery and assault and will appear in a children's court at a later date.

Police said another 11-year-old girl was released pending summons.
